China is racing ahead in the global energy landscape, unveiling a series of groundbreaking power plant mega-projects that promise to redefine the future of energy consumption and production. With a relentless pursuit of innovation, China’s latest advancements include the launch of the third-generation nuclear power unit at the Taisha Nuclear Power Plant in Guangdong, developed through a joint venture with France. This state-of-the-art facility marks a significant milestone in nuclear technology, showcasing China’s commitment to energy independence and sustainability.
In a remarkable display of international cooperation, China’s energy initiatives are also making waves in Pakistan. The Jacok Coal Power Plant, part of the China-Pakistan Economic Corridor, began operations with a staggering capacity of 1.32 gigawatts, set to power four million households and alleviate the nation’s energy crisis. This project underscores the critical role China plays in bolstering energy infrastructure across borders, fueling development and stability.
Moreover, China’s first offshore nuclear power plant in Fujian has officially commenced operations, contributing 16% of the province’s energy needs while significantly reducing greenhouse gas emissions. This ambitious project, constructed over eight years on three islands, illustrates China’s strategic approach to harnessing clean energy sources.
As the world watches, China continues to expand its nuclear capabilities, with 30 operational plants and 24 under construction, including the largest nuclear facility on the mainland, the Chinchin Nuclear Power Plant, which has been a cornerstone of energy production since the early ’90s.
